Miss Millennial Philippines (MMP) is an annual beauty pageant for female beauty queens from the millennial generation who are beautiful, talented, and intelligent.

Eat Bulaga! tapped local pageant titleholders from across the Philippines and challenged them to represent their hometown in a competition that is first of its kind in local television.

Unlike typical beauty pageants, Miss Millennial Philippines places a great emphasis on the culture of the provinces and cities from which each of the candidates originated.

Throughout the pageant's run, the candidates must provide a visual tour of must-see destinations, showcase local delicacies, and promote the world-renowned Filipino hospitality. The pageant's goal is to make Filipinos realize how beautiful the Philippines truly is.

The official theme music of Miss Millennial Philippines was performed by Music Hero vocalist Rangel Fernandez.

Miss Millennial Philippines 2017

Miss Millennial Philippines 2017 is the first edition of the pageant that premiered on 29 July 2017 and concluded on 30 September 2017.

Julia Novel Gonowon of Camarines Sur was crowned as the first-ever grand winner of Miss Millennial Philippines, winning against thirty-seven other candidates.

Carina Cariño of La Union placed as first runner-up, while Eleonora Valentina Laorenza of Aklan won as the second runner-up. Shiara Joy Dizon of Malabon City bagged the title of third runner-up. Meanwhile, Dianne Irish Joy Lacayanga of Ilocos Norte was named as the Bayanihan Queen.

Contestant Origin Result
Julia Novel Gonowon Camarines Sur Grand winner
Carina Cariño La Union First runner-up
Eleonora Valentina Laorenza Aklan Second runner-up
Shiara Joy Dizon Malabon City Third runner-up

Miss Millennial Philippines 2018

Miss Millennial Philippines 2018 is the second edition of the pageant that premiered on 25 August 2018 and concluded on 27 October 2018.

Shaila Mae Rebortera of Cebu was crowned as the grand winner of Miss Millennial Philippines 2018, winning against thirty-nine other candidates.

Danna Rose Socaoco of Misamis Oriental placed as first runner-up, while Chanel Mistyca Villamor Corpuz of Abra won as second runner-up. Marrielle Sarmiento of Oriental Mindoro bagged the title of third runner-up. Meanwhile, Marela Glospeah Caro Juaman of South Cotabato was named as the Bayanihan Queen.

Contestant Origin Result
Shaila Mae Rebortera Cebu Grand winner
Danna Rose Socaoco Misamis Oriental First runner-up
Chanel Mistyca Villamor Corpuz Abra Second runner-up
Marrielle Sarmiento Oriental Mindoro Third runner-up

Miss Millennial Philippines 2019

Miss Millennial Philippines 2019 is the third edition of the pageant that premiered on 31 August 2019 and concluded on 26 October 2019.

Nicole Yance Borromeo of Cebu was crowned as the grand winner of Miss Millennial Philippines 2019, making it a back-to-back victory for the province who also won last year's pageant.

Angela Maria Robson of Pampanga placed as first runner-up, while Annabelle Mae Tate McDonnell of Lanao del Norte won as second runner-up. Maica Cabling Martinez of Nueva Ecija bagged the title of third runner-up.

Contestant Origin Result
Nicole Yance Borromeo Cebu Grand winner
Angela Maria Robson Pampanga First runner-up
Annabelle Mae Tate McDonnell Lanao del Norte Second runner-up
Maica Cabling Martinez Nueva Ecija Third runner-up
